|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single Roof Section Repair | $1,200 - $2,500 |
| Full Roof Shingle Replacement | $7,000 - $12,000 |
| Partial Shingle Replacement | $2,000 - $4,000 |
| Decking Repair & Replacement | $3,500 - $6,500 |
| Roof Inspection & Assessment | $300 - $700 |
| Complete Shingle Overhaul |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Emergency Repairs | $1,500 - $3,500 |
Key Cost Factors
Wood shingle repair in Farmington, MO, involves addressing damaged or deteriorated shingles to restore the roof's appearance and functionality. Understanding typical project considerations can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.
- Materials: Commonly used materials include cedar, pine, or redwood shingles, selected based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
- Size and Scope: Repairs can range from small patch jobs to replacing entire sections of shingles, depending on the extent of damage.
- Labor Complexity: The complexity varies with the roof's pitch, accessibility, and extent of damage, influencing the overall effort required.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Farmington may require permits for larger repair projects or significant roof work.
- Extras: Additional work such as replacing underlayment, flashing, or addressing underlying structural issues can impact project scope and cost.
